Transaction 1734af5612f0929d677d16ed24846034beb9aeced2442d2e5962ea93f932675a

1 Input
2 Outputs
  • 1734af5612f0929d677d16ed24846034beb9aeced2442d2e5962ea93f932675a:0
  • value  107637
    address  3Gi9HqPenM6u4hjr1tV9fR81NzS6Tc2JRS
  • 1734af5612f0929d677d16ed24846034beb9aeced2442d2e5962ea93f932675a:1
  • value  273668
    address  1KQdEBWhEeHRDKLhaFnsVBA7FTKP389Zjg